Abstract

This work studies the application of differential space time block code (STBC) for wireless multi-hop sensor networks in fading channel. We select multiple sensors as parallel relay nodes to receive and transmit signals from the previous hop. These relay nodes do not exchange symbols with each other but forward the symbols in parallel to the destination using STBCs. The proposed technique has low complexity even when the number of parallel relays grows, since it does not need to track or estimate the time-varying channel coefficients. The steady state network performance measures, such as network throughput and transmission delay, are analyzed via Markov chain modelling. Compared to the traditional single relay routing method, our proposed method offers improved performance.
